Summary: | The rapid development and deployment of Lethal Autonomous Weapons Systems (LAWS) and drones have raised significant legal, ethical, and operational challenges for the entire international community. This paper examines the implications of these technologies within the context of international law, focusing on the principles of sovereignty, accountability, and compliance with humanitarian law. It discusses the potential risks posed by autonomous decision-making in warfare, including the lack of human oversight and the challenges in assigning responsibility for unlawful actions. Furthermore, the paper explores existing frameworks, such as the Geneva Conventions and the Convention on Certain Conventional Weapons, in addressing the use of LAWS and drones, while considering the limitations of these treaties in regulating emerging technologies. Finally, the research proposes recommendations for the development of new legal norms that balance technological advancements with human rights and international security concerns. |
